Set on the ocean planet of Abzu, just like Oshan Laboratory, the Neon Deepwater Research Facility (or Neon for short) is set in the midst of a strange coral reef made out of plasmastone, inhabited by unusually large and aggressive jellyfish (and, according to rumors, much larger creatures), hiding some unique genetic mutations. The surrounding seafloor is dotted with hydrothermal vents that release various gases, while the nearby ocean currents provide a steady supply of power for the relatively small crew.
Gameplay-wise, it's meant for relatively small numbers of players, though that doesn't prevent it from having plenty of nooks and crannies for antagonist mischief.
April 27, 2025 to Present
